Baltica 2 offshore wind project, Poland

Name of the Project
Baltica 2 offshore wind project.

Location
About 40 km from the northern coast of Poland, between Łeba and Ustka.

Project Owner/s
PGE Group and Ørsted.

Project Description
The project forms part of the Baltica Offshore Wind Farm, the biggest offshore wind project in the Polish part of the Baltic Sea.

The project will strengthen the energy security of the Polish economy. One hundred and seven 14 MW
wind turbines will be supplied to the project.

The project will avoid the emission of about 5.4-million tons of carbon dioxide emissions a year, or the equivalent emissions from an estimated 3.6-million diesel cars. It will also provide electricity for about 2.4-million homes in Poland.

Planned Start/End Date
The project is expected to come online in 2027.

Key Contracts, Suppliers and Consultants
Siemens Gamesa (wind turbines).
